The role

You will report to Senior Manager Gippsland and your responsibilities will include providing intensive, early intervention support for young people at risk of disengaging from education.

As part of the Gippsland Primary Health Network Mental Health Supports for Bushfire Affected Australians program, you will deliver holistic, high quality and culturally sensitive therapeutic case management.

You will work closely with other relevant organisations to deliver community outreach and services promotion. Your role will also assist with the coordination of education programs to young people to help them re-engage into education.

You will work flexibly, delivering services in individual and group settings at both on-site and off-site locations, including schools.

This role is located in Bairnsdale, with outreach to Lakes Entrance and is a casual position. Our standard business hours are Monday to Friday 9am to 5pm. Whilst this is casual, you can anticipate that you may be rostered to work approximately one to three days per week.

About you:

  • Degree in social work, counselling, or related field.
  • Demonstrated experience in working with young people from a child-centred and strength-based perspective in a setting relevant to the role.
  • Proven organisational skills with the ability to prioritise and manage own workload to meet timeframes and job-related expectations.
  • Good all-round computer skills and literacy, having used the Microsoft Office suite including Outlook, Word etc.
